AI Trading Bots: How They Work and Best Practices
In the rapidly evolving world of cryptocurrency trading, AI trading bots have emerged as a powerful tool for investors seeking to capitalize on market opportunities. These automated systems harness th...
# AI Trading Bots: How They Work and Best Practices In the rapidly evolving world of cryptocurrency trading, AI trading bots have emerged as a powerful tool for investors seeking to capitalize on market opportunities. These automated systems harness the capabilities of artificial intelligence to analyze market data, execute trades, and manage portfolios with minimal human intervention. However, as with any trading strategy, understanding how these bots work and implementing effective risk management practices is crucial for success. ## Understanding AI Trading Bots AI trading bots are software programs that use algorithms to automate trading decisions based on market analysis. Here’s how they generally function: - **Data Collection**: Bots gather vast amounts of data from various sources, including price movements, trading volumes, and social media sentiment. - **Algorithmic Analysis**: Advanced algorithms analyze this data to identify trends and patterns that can indicate potential trading opportunities. - **Execution of Trades**: Once a trading opportunity is identified, the bot can execute trades automatically, often at speeds that far exceed human capability. ### Example: A Simple Trading Bot Strategy Imagine you set up an AI trading bot to trade Bitcoin. You program it to buy when the price drops by 5% within an hour and sell when it rises by 3%. The bot monitors the market 24/7, executing trades based on these parameters without needing your constant oversight. ## Best Practices for Using AI Trading Bots While AI trading bots can enhance your trading strategy, it's essential to implement best practices to mitigate risks: ### 1. Start with a Demo Account Before deploying a trading bot with real funds, use a demo account to test its performance. This allows you to understand: - How the bot responds to market fluctuations - The effectiveness of your chosen strategy - The bot's execution speed and order placement ### 2. Set Realistic Expectations AI trading bots are not a guaranteed path to profit. It's crucial to understand: - **Market Volatility**: Cryptocurrency markets can be unpredictable, and even the best algorithms can incur losses. - **Profit Targets**: Set achievable profit targets to avoid overexposure to risk. ### 3. Implement Risk Management Techniques Risk management is vital when using trading bots. Consider these strategies: - **Position Sizing**: Determine how much of your capital you are willing to risk on each trade. A common rule is to risk no more than 1-2% of your total portfolio per trade. - **Stop-Loss Orders**: Use stop-loss orders to limit potential losses. For example, if you buy Bitcoin at $30,000, you might set a stop-loss at $28,500 to protect your investment. - **Diversification**: Avoid putting all your capital into one asset or strategy. Diversifying across different cryptocurrencies can help manage risk. ### 4. Monitor and Adjust Regularly Even automated systems require oversight. Regularly review your bot's performance and make necessary adjustments: - **Performance Metrics**: Keep track of metrics such as win rate, average profit/loss, and drawdown. - **Market Conditions**: Adjust your bot’s parameters to align with changing market conditions. For instance, a bot that performs well in a bull market may need adjustments during a bear market. ## Conclusion AI trading bots can be a valuable asset for cryptocurrency traders looking to enhance their trading strategies and optimize their time. However, success with these tools requires a strong focus on risk management and an understanding of market dynamics. By starting with demo accounts, setting realistic expectations, implementing effective risk management practices, and regularly monitoring performance, traders can harness the power of AI while safeguarding their investments. Remember, the goal is not just to automate trading but to do so intelligently and safely.